Thousands more British students to study in China

China Education News    

At least 15,000 students a year will be encouraged to take courses in China as part of a Government-backed drive to boost British business. The move comes amid fears that Britain currently lags behind other nations in terms of the number of students seeking courses and work placements abroad – limiting the number of connections made with other countries. The British Council said around 3,500 students travelled to China in 2011 but it wanted the number to grow to at 15,000 by 2016.
